Soldier Field

  • Nashville SC vs. Chicago Fire FC – Sat. 4/4 at 7:30 p.m.

Service:

  • Rail: The Red, Orange and Green lines provide the closest access to Soldier Field. Exit at the Roosevelt station.
  • Bus: Service on the #146 Inner Lake Shore/Michigan Express route.

Rate Field:

  • Toronto Blue Jays vs. White Sox – Home Opener: Fri. 4/3 at 1:10 p.m., Sat. 4/4 and Sun. 4/5 at 1:10 p.m.
  • Baltimore Orioles vs. White Sox – Mon. 4/6 and Tue. 4/7 at 6:07 p.m., Wed. 4/8 at 2:07 p.m.

Service:

  • Red Line: Rate Field is just one block west of the Sox-35th station.
  • Green Line: The 35th-Bronzeville-IIT station is just three blocks east of the ballpark.
  • #35 31st/35th: The #35 route (which connects with Orange and Green lines) is the main bus route providing service to the stadium and operates during all game times.
  • Adjacent bus routes: Several CTA bus routes serve the ballpark area, including:
    • #1 Bronzeville/Union Station (during Monday – Friday rush periods only)
    • #4 Cottage Grove
    • #24 Wentworth (which runs Monday – Friday to 8:30 p.m.)
    • #29 State
    • #31 31st (which runs Monday – Friday to 7 p.m.)
    • #39 Pershing (which connects with Orange and Green lines)
    • #44 Wallace/Racine

Construction Work to Temporarily Impact Brown Line Service

  • Between 2:45 a.m. on Mon. 4/6 and 10 p.m. on Fri. 4/17, Loop-bound Brown Line trains will not stop at the Western station. (More details)
  • For Loop-bound service from this station, take a Kimball-bound train to Rockwell and transfer to a Lop-bound train.
  • For Loop-bound service to this station, take a Loop-bound train to Damen and transfer to a Kimball-bound train.
  • This service change is due to improvements at the Western Brown Line station.

Weekend Work to Temporarily Impact Orange Line Service

  • Between 6 a.m. and 4 p.m. on Sat. 4/4, rail service on the Orange Line will operate on the same track between Midway and Kedzie. (More details)
  • Customers should board/exit all trains on the Midway-bound side of the platform at the Pulaski station.
  • This service change is due to track maintenance work to ensure that trains continue to operate safely along the Orange Line.
